Synonymous with Rock and Roll, Fender Musical Instruments Corporation, has become one of the world’s leading guitar manufacturers. Known worldwide for the manufacture of the Telecaster, Precision Bass, and Jazz Bass guitars, Fender guitars continue to be considered one of the number one guitar manufacturers of the musicians of the past and today.
The history of Fender Musical Instruments dates back to 1946, and since then has been a part of and changed music industry worldwide in various genres; rock and roll, jazz, rhythm and blues and even country and western among others. Other brands currently being manufactured by Fender Musical Instruments is Squier, Guild, Jackson, and Charvel. Models of guitars manufactured by Fender include; the Stratocaster, the Telecaster, and the Sonoran S Natural Acoustic guitar just to name a few.
The Stratocaster is a model of electric guitar that was first manufactured in 1954 and is still being manufactured today. The design of this guitar is that of a double-cutaway guitar that has an extended top horn in order to be able to better balance it when standing. Many guitarists have used this particular model of guitar in their recordings.
This model of guitar is one of the most common electric guitars used. The design of this electric guitar has transcended over time just like the various styles of music that has been played on it.
The Telecaster is a simple designed, dual-pickup, solid-body electric guitar. The design and sound of this guitar has broken ground and set trends in the manufacture of electric guitars and all kinds of music. Originally, in 1946, it was called the Broadcaster, it is the first guitar of this kind to be produced in large quantities.
Over time, it has remained in continuous production in various forms, which has earned it the title of the oldest solid-body electric guitar.
